Why You Can't See Recent Follows in Order Anymore
Before October 2021, Instagram had an Instagram following activity tab inside the notification bell. It showed which accounts someone recently followed, in chronological order — updated in real time. People used it to keep tabs on partners, track competitors, and follow what influencers were doing. It was one of the most-used features on the platform.

Instagram removed it in October 2021, citing privacy concerns. The official reasoning was that people didn't know others could monitor their activity so closely. Since then, the following list still exists on public accounts — but it's sorted by an algorithm that Instagram doesn't explain and doesn't let you override. You can open someone's Following tab today and see 600 accounts in an order that tells you nothing about when any of them were added.
